7 drug traffickers arrested in Deir ez-Zor and Manbij

The Internal Security Forces of North and East Syria arrested 7 drug users and traffickers in the cantons of Deir ez-Zor and Manbij.

The Internal Security Forces of North and East Syria arrested 5 drug traffickers and users during an operation in Deir ez-Zor on 13 October. They seized 27.5 grams of crystal meth, cannabis, equipment, $400, documents and ID cards, and 5 phones.

On 18 October, Anti-Drug Forces captured 2 drug traffickers in Manbij Canton with 4,000 drug pills, a Kalashnikov pistol and 2 magazines hidden in a motorbike.

Stressing their commitment to their duty to protect society from drugs, the Anti-Drug Forces noted that the people of the region should inform them about any suspicious activity related to drug use, sale and trade.
